Technical Field
The invention belongs to a disinfection combination device for a street blood sampling vehicle.
Background
The blood collection vehicle stays at the street to allow all people to voluntarily donate blood, but because vehicles at the street are many, dust causes bacteria to be several times of that in hospitals, especially when blood donors and medical staff enter the blood collection vehicle, the dust and germs brought by clothes and shoes are countless, especially when the bacteria and dust on the shoes are countless, so that the blood donors have the risk of polluting blood sources when taking blood, and the consequences if the polluted blood sources enter the operation are not imaginable.
Disclosure of Invention
The invention provides a disinfection combination device for a street blood sampling vehicle, which is arranged in an entrance, reduces the entry of external bacteria and germs, reduces the hazards polluting blood sources and ensures the quality of the blood sources.

The invention has the following beneficial effects:
1. the first step 29 and the second step 30 are both provided with new ultraviolet lamps for secondary disinfection, so that the probability of killing bacteria and dust is increased;
2. the shoe cover box can reduce the flying of dust and bacteria on shoes and reduce the probability of polluting blood sampling vehicle devices;
3. the shoe cover is rolled on the shoe cover shaft, one end of the shoe cover shaft is connected with the screwing spring, and the spring is fixed with the rack to keep the shoe cover on the guide plate tight;
4. the shoe cover box can be used for mounting a large number of shoe covers at one time, and the trouble of frequent mounting is avoided.

When the shoe covers are sleeved, feet are stretched into the annular cutter to step down the pedal, the pedal moves downwards to drive the cutter to cut off the shoe covers along the outside of the indentation, the shoe covers shrink on the shoes due to the loss of tension, and meanwhile, the pedal slides descend through treading by people to drive the spiral iron covers to rotate and descend. The chain is pulled by the spiral iron sleeve, the chain drives the flywheel to rotate and the spring to extend, and the flywheel rotates without driving the roller to rotate. When the foot leaves the pedal, the spring contracts to drive the chain and then the flywheel to rotate, and the flywheel drives the roller to rotate to complete the action of replacing the shoe cover.
